Azadeh Ensha
Azadeh Ensha (Persian: آزاده انشاﻋ, born in Tehran, Iran) is an Iranian-American journalist who works for The New York Times.[1] She has written for the business, foreign, metro, style and culture desks.

Personal
    
Fluent in Persian and French, Ensha graduated summa cum laude, Phi Beta Kappa from UCLA and received a master's degree from the Columbia University Graduate School of Journalism.
